Transaction 24e8617a39ca9ac3c8db49478637879d790c7e0a93426f7d00496f502532a907
1 Input
2 Outputs
- 24e8617a39ca9ac3c8db49478637879d790c7e0a93426f7d00496f502532a907:0
- 24e8617a39ca9ac3c8db49478637879d790c7e0a93426f7d00496f502532a907:1
value 1108789
address 3BMEXzUhZ7NdHZER2kM4apDP7LaQrtyHxb
value 1068589
address 1Psk2RSs3qnazZQBVJZ8H4X44HDV7658x5